NASA Backs Wild Plan for a Laser-Powered Drone to Explore Giant Caves Below the Moon's Surface
NASA awarded $175,000 for preliminary research into lunar cave-spelunking drones as part of $3.2 million dispersed via its “innovative advanced concepts” awards this summer.
